Skip to content

regression: this relaxed bound is not permitted here (accepted breakage; downstream patched) #147963

@BoxyUwU

Description

@BoxyUwU
[INFO] [stdout] error: this relaxed bound is not permitted here
[INFO] [stdout]   --> /opt/rustwide/cargo-home/registry/src/index.crates.io-1949cf8c6b5b557f/arch-pkg-text-0.9.0/src/desc/query/generic.rs:46:39
[INFO] [stdout]    |
[INFO] [stdout] 46 | impl<Ptr: Deref<Target: ReuseAdvice + ?Sized>> ReuseAdvice for Pin<Ptr> {
[INFO] [stdout]    |                                       ^^^^^^
[INFO] [stdout]    |
[INFO] [stdout]    = note: in this context, relaxed bounds are only allowed on type parameters defined by the closest item

Metadata

Metadata

Assignees

No one assigned

    Labels

    S-has-bisectionStatus: A bisection has been found for this issueT-compilerRelevant to the compiler team, which will review and decide on the PR/issue.regression-from-stable-to-betaPerformance or correctness regression from stable to beta.

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ions